Mastering Advanced Troubleshooting Techniques for Cloud Infrastructure Failures
Most professionals rush to reboot or revert when cloud infrastructure fails, assuming simple fixes always apply. However, advanced troubleshooting techniques for cloud infrastructure failures require a far more nuanced approach than sheer reaction speed.
Why Conventional Troubleshooting Often Falls Short in the Cloud
Cloud environments are inherently complex and dynamic. Dependencies between microservices, varying API responses, and fluctuating network conditions mean that straightforward symptom-to-solution logic can mislead engineers. Without drilling down into contextual data and system behavior over time, attempts at quick fixes risk prolonging outages.
This complexity is precisely why I prioritize a structured methodology grounded in detailed diagnostics rather than assumption-based actions.
Diving Deep: Technical Processes Behind Effective Cloud Failure Diagnostics
My approach starts with comprehensive log aggregation across distributed services. Correlating timestamps helps identify cascading failures versus isolated incidents. Next, I utilize automated anomaly detection algorithms powered by machine learning to flag irregular patterns invisible to manual review.
Additionally, hooking into real-time telemetry provides live insights into resource bottlenecks—CPU spikes, memory leaks, or network congestion. By combining these inputs, I can pinpoint not just where but why the failure originated.
A Real-World Incident That Showcased These Approaches in Action
At one point while managing a multinational e-commerce platform's infrastructure, our team faced an obscure slowdown affecting global checkout transactions intermittently. Initial guesses blamed database shards or CDN latency but tests refuted those hypotheses repeatedly.
Applying the layered diagnostics I described uncovered subtle race conditions in an authentication microservice triggered under peak load — an issue invisible in routine monitoring dashboards. Rectifying this involved asynchronous queue redesign and deploying additional resource limits dynamically.
Recommended Toolset to Implement Advanced Cloud Troubleshooting
- Centralized log management platforms like ELK Stack or Splunk for comprehensive data capture
- Anomaly detection frameworks including Prometheus coupled with Grafana for visualization
- Distributed tracing tools such as Jaeger or OpenTelemetry to follow request lifecycles end-to-end
Proactively combining these utilities into your system architecture greatly enhances fault diagnosis speed and accuracy.
Adopting advanced troubleshooting techniques for cloud infrastructure failures means embracing complexity without being overwhelmed by it. The combination of structured analysis, smart tooling, and patience transforms disruptive outages into manageable challenges.
If you want to elevate your operational resilience further, consider downloading specialized automation tools designed explicitly to integrate these methodologies seamlessly into your existing workflows.
Take 60 seconds and scan this post again for one thing: what they clearly prioritize, and what they ignore.
- Headline test: what promise do they lead with?
- Mechanism test: what do they say “works” (without hype)?
- Proof of focus: do they repeat one message everywhere?
Then come back and compare what you noticed to the framework in the post.